Defining Acoustic Foam Panels Hexagon: What Are They, Really?

Simply put, acoustic foam panels hexagon are sound-absorbing materials molded or cut into hexagonal shapes, designed primarily to improve room acoustics. Unlike flat sheets, their geometry increases surface area and disperses sound waves more evenly, reducing reflections and standing waves.

These panels typically consist of polyurethane foam with open-cell structures, which traps sound energy through friction and conversion into heat. But the hexagon shape also enables easier interlocking, flexible configurations, and visually appealing layouts—making them a favored choice for professional audio studios and educational institutions seeking better hearing environments.

Key Factors to Keep in Mind When Selecting Acoustic Foam Panels Hexagon

1. Durability and Fire Resistance

You want panels that last. Many manufacturers now treat foams to resist fire, mold, and humidity — especially vital in commercial installations and humid climates. A durable panel means less replacement and better long-term investment.

2. Scalability & Installation Ease

Thanks to the hexagonal tessellation, these panels fit together seamlessly, scaling from small project studios to complete wall coverings naturally. Installation tends to be quicker compared to irregular shapes — a blessing for busy contractors or DIY-enthusiasts.

3. Cost Efficiency and Material Quality

Price varies widely, but many companies now use recycled or bio-based polyfoam, balancing performance with budget and sustainability needs. Higher density usually correlates with better sound absorption but also increased cost.

4. Acoustic Performance (NRC Ratings)

The Noise Reduction Coefficient (NRC) is the key measurement here. Most quality acoustic foam panels hexagon hit somewhere between 0.6 and 0.9 NRC — in human terms, that's notably quieter rooms.

5. Aesthetic Flexibility

Available in various colors and finishes, these panels can be customized to fit corporate branding, artistic environments, or soothing educational spaces — proving that soundproofing need not compromise style.

Obstacles and How Experts Are Tackling Them

The main challenge? These panels don't block sound entirely — they absorb it. So in places with heavy external noise, they’re part of a package, not a stand-alone. Also, poor-quality foam can degrade or emit odors over time, an issue manufacturers combat with better materials.

Installation can be tricky in irregular spaces; new mounting systems and modular hex designs alleviate this. Finally, scaling production sustainably while maintaining quality is a balancing act, but the trend toward greener materials looks promising.

FAQ: Acoustic Foam Panels Hexagon Explained

Q1: What advantages do hexagonal panels have over traditional square acoustic foam panels?
Hexagonal panels offer better acoustic diffusion due to their shape, reducing standing waves more effectively. Their tessellating nature allows seamless wall coverage with fewer gaps, and the aesthetic can be more dynamic and customizable.
Q2: How long do these panels typically last in commercial settings?
With quality materials and proper care, acoustic foam panels hexagon can last 5-10 years or more. Exposure to UV light or moisture reduces lifespan, so installation in protected areas is recommended.
Q3: Are acoustic foam panels hexagon environmentally friendly?
Traditional polyurethane foam isn't biodegradable, but many manufacturers now use recycled content and greener chemical processes. Certifications increasingly assess environmental impact to guide eco-conscious buyers.
Q4: Can these panels be installed in outdoor or humid environments?
Most foam panels are best suited for indoor use. However, moisture-resistant treatments and protective coatings allow limited outdoor or humid area applications. Always check product specifications for such use.
